Title :
Carrier transfer between InGaAs/GaAs quantum dots observed by differential transmission spectroscopy
Author :
Verman, K. L Sil ; Mirin, Richard P. ; Cundiff, S.T.
Author_Institution :
Nat. Inst. of Stand. & Technol., Boulder, CO
Abstract :
We employ two-color differential transmission spectroscopy to investigate coupling between InGaAs/GaAs QDs. Resonantly excited carriers escape and are captured by non-resonant dots with a time constant of 32 ps at room temperature
